How does South Dakota car shipping work?
South Dakota car shipping works by matching your vehicle, route, and timing with a carrier that can safely service your pickup and delivery locations. In many cases, carriers moving through South Dakota rely on I-90 running east to west across the state and I-29 serving the eastern corridor near Sioux Falls and Brookings. Those routes help make many South Dakota moves more efficient than people expect, especially when pickup and delivery windows are flexible.
For more rural areas, delivery may still be door-to-door if a truck can safely access the address. If road width, neighborhood restrictions, farm access, or weather conditions make that difficult, the driver may coordinate a nearby meeting point such as a shopping center, large lot, or other safe open area.
- Request your quote and choose open or enclosed transport.
- Schedule your shipment around your preferred window.
- Your vehicle is picked up, inspected, and loaded.
- You receive updates while the vehicle is in transit.
- The car is delivered and inspected again at drop-off.

What does South Dakota car shipping usually cost?
South Dakota car shipping cost depends on distance, route popularity, vehicle size, trailer type, season, and how flexible your pickup window is. Routes touching larger markets like Sioux Falls or Rapid City can price differently than more remote rural areas because carrier access and load planning affect the final rate.
| Route Type | Open Transport | Enclosed Transport | What changes the price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Shorter regional move | About $500–$900 | About $900–$1,400 | Pickup flexibility, vehicle size, operability, access conditions |
| Mid-range interstate move | About $850–$1,300 | About $1,250–$1,900 | Route demand, weather, fuel, trailer space, exact cities |
| Long-distance / cross-country move | About $1,100–$1,850+ | About $1,700–$2,550+ | Seasonality, rural access, expedited timing, vehicle dimensions |
These are planning ranges, not guaranteed quotes. The best way to price a South Dakota shipment is to compare the exact route, vehicle, and timing.
What factors affect the price to ship a car in South Dakota?
Route and distance
The biggest pricing factor is usually how far the vehicle is traveling and how easy the route is for a carrier to service.
Open vs enclosed transport
Open transport is the standard and usually the lower-cost option. Enclosed shipping adds protection and usually costs more.
Vehicle size and weight
Larger pickups, SUVs, and heavier vehicles can affect both trailer space and route planning.
Season and weather
Winter conditions, wind, and seasonal demand can change schedules and pricing on South Dakota routes.
Operable vs inoperable
Non-running vehicles often require special equipment or extra loading time, which can increase the quote.
Exact pickup and delivery access
Remote roads, ranch access, or restricted neighborhoods can require alternate meeting locations.
Should you choose open or enclosed South Dakota auto transport?
Most South Dakota vehicle shipments move on open carriers, while enclosed transport is usually the better fit for luxury, classic, exotic, or specialty vehicles. Open transport is the common choice because it is widely available and cost-effective. Enclosed shipping adds more protection from road debris and weather exposure, which matters more for certain vehicles and owners.
- Open transport: best for most daily drivers, SUVs, and trucks.
- Enclosed transport: better for collector cars, show cars, high-value vehicles, or low-clearance units.
- Expedited options: may be available when timing matters more than flexibility.

How long does South Dakota car shipping take?
Transit time depends on the route, weather, traffic, and where your pickup and delivery locations sit relative to major carrier lanes. Carriers often average roughly 400 to 500 miles per day under normal conditions, but weather, seasonal demand, and route planning can affect that pace.
| Move distance | Typical transit range | What to expect |
|---|---|---|
| Regional | 1–3 days | Often the fastest when origin and destination are near active lanes. |
| Mid-range interstate | 3–6 days | Common for routes connecting South Dakota with surrounding midwestern and western states. |
| Cross-country | 6–10+ days | Longer routes depend heavily on season, lane demand, and exact endpoints. |
Pickup timing is separate from transit time. Standard pickup windows are often broader than delivery windows, while expedited service may shorten the wait when available.

How should you prepare your vehicle for South Dakota auto transport?
Preparing your vehicle before pickup helps the carrier inspect, load, and deliver it with fewer delays. A little preparation also helps avoid confusion during the inspection process.
- Wash the vehicle so the inspection is easier to complete.
- Take dated photos before pickup.
- Remove personal items and toll tags.
- Leave about a quarter tank of fuel.
- Disable alarms if possible.
- Provide a working key.
- Let your coordinator know about modifications, leaks, or operability issues.
Frequently asked questions about South Dakota car shipping
Can you ship a car to rural South Dakota?
Yes. Many rural South Dakota shipments are possible, but if the exact address is difficult for a large carrier to access safely, the driver may arrange a nearby meeting point.
Is enclosed transport worth it for South Dakota?
Enclosed transport is often worth considering for classic, luxury, exotic, or specialty vehicles, especially when additional protection matters more than the lowest price.
How far in advance should I book South Dakota auto transport?
Booking earlier usually gives you more carrier options and more pricing flexibility. Last-minute requests can still be possible, but availability and price may vary by route and timing.
Can you ship trucks and SUVs in South Dakota?
Yes. Trucks and SUVs can often be shipped, though larger or heavier vehicles may affect the quote because they take up more trailer space and can change the route plan.
Does weather affect South Dakota car shipping?
Yes. Winter weather, wind, and seasonal road conditions can affect both pickup timing and transit estimates, so realistic scheduling matters on South Dakota routes.
